ProHealth Care, located in Waukesha, WI, provides a full range of substance use treatment options for both adults and children who also face mental health challenges. The center offers various programs, including intensive outpatient, outpatient, and regular outpatient treatments. Emphasizing methods like 12-step facilitation, anger management, and brief interventions, ProHealth Care specifically addresses the needs of clients with dual diagnoses. This facility welcomes patients of all genders, ensuring that each individual receives personalized care.
